Better batteries? Going beyond the surface of oxide films

Better batteries? Going beyond the surface of oxide films

Researchers at the Department of Energy lab learned that key surface properties of complex oxide films are unaffected by reduced levels of oxygen during fabrication -- an unanticipated finding with possible implications for the design of functional complex oxides used in a variety of consumer products, said Zheng Gai, a member of DOE's Center for Nanoscale Materials Sciences at ORNL.

The findings are detailed in a paper published in Nanoscale.

While the properties of the manganite material below the surface change as expected with the removal of oxygen, becoming an insulator rather than a metal, or conductor, researchers found that the sample showed remarkably stable electronic properties at the surface. Gai emphasized that the robustness of a surface matters because it is precisely the surface properties that determine, influence and affect the functionality of complex oxides in catalysis and batteries.

"With these materials being a promising alternative to silicon or graphene in electronic devices, the ever-decreasing size of such components makes their surface properties increasingly important to understand and control," Gai said.

While this work provides a fundamental understanding of a material used and researched for catalysts, oxide electronics and batteries, Gai and lead author Paul Snijders noted that it's difficult to speculate about possible impacts.

"I always say that in basic science we are discovering the alphabet," said Snijders, a member of ORNL's Materials Science and Technology Division. "How these letters will be designed into a useful technological book is hard to predict."

Making this discovery possible was the fact the authors did their experiment using scanning probe microscopy in a vacuum system with no exposure of the samples to the atmosphere. This contrasts with the conventional approach of growing a sample and then installing it in analysis equipment. During such a transfer, scientists expose the material to the water, nitrogen and carbon dioxide in the air.

By studying pristine samples, the ORNL team gained a surprising new understanding of the physics of the material surfaces -- an understanding that is necessary to design new functional applications, Snijders said.

Other authors of the paper, titled "Persistent metal-insulator transition at the surface of an oxygen-deficient, epitaxial manganite film," are Min Gao, Hangwen Guo, Guixin Cao, Wolter Siemons and Thomas Ward of ORNL, Hongjun Gao of the Chinese Academy of Sciences and Jian Shen of Fudan University, China. Min Gao and Snijders contributed equally to this work, which was funded by DOE's Basic Energy Sciences. A portion of the research was conducted at the Center for Nanophase Materials Sciences.

New rechargeable flow battery could enable cheaper, more efficient energy storage

New rechargeable flow battery could enable cheaper, more efficient energy storage

Aug. 16, 2013 — MIT researchers have engineered a new rechargeable flow battery that doesn't rely on expensive membranes to generate and store electricity. The device, they say, may one day enable cheaper, large-scale energy storage.

The palm-sized prototype generates three times as much power per square centimeter as other membraneless systems -- a power density that is an order of magnitude higher than that of many lithium-ion batteries and other commercial and experimental energy-storage systems.

The device stores and releases energy in a device that relies on a phenomenon called laminar flow: Two liquids are pumped through a channel, undergoing electrochemical reactions between two electrodes to store or release energy. Under the right conditions, the solutions stream through in parallel, with very little mixing. The flow naturally separates the liquids, without requiring a costly membrane.

The reactants in the battery consist of a liquid bromine solution and hydrogen fuel. The group chose to work with bromine because the chemical is relatively inexpensive and available in large quantities, with more than 243,000 tons produced each year in the United States.

In addition to bromine's low cost and abundance, the chemical reaction between hydrogen and bromine holds great potential for energy storage. But fuel-cell designs based on hydrogen and bromine have largely had mixed results: Hydrobromic acid tends to eat away at a battery's membrane, effectively slowing the energy-storing reaction and reducing the battery's lifetime.

To circumvent these issues, the team landed on a simple solution: Take out the membrane.

"This technology has as much promise as anything else being explored for storage, if not more," says Cullen Buie, an assistant professor of mechanical engineering at MIT. "Contrary to previous opinions that membraneless systems are purely academic, this system could potentially have a large practical impact."

Buie, along with Martin Bazant, a professor of chemical engineering, and William Braff, a graduate student in mechanical engineering, have published their results this week in Nature Communications.

"Here, we have a system where performance is just as good as previous systems, and now we don't have to worry about issues of the membrane," Bazant says. "This is something that can be a quantum leap in energy-storage technology."

Possible boost for solar and wind energy

Low-cost energy storage has the potential to foster widespread use of renewable energy, such as solar and wind power. To date, such energy sources have been unreliable: Winds can be capricious, and cloudless days are never guaranteed. With cheap energy-storage technologies, renewable energy might be stored and then distributed via the electric grid at times of peak power demand.

"Energy storage is the key enabling technology for renewables," Buie says. "Until you can make [energy storage] reliable and affordable, it doesn't matter how cheap and efficient you can make wind and solar, because our grid can't handle the intermittency of those renewable technologies."

By designing a flow battery without a membrane, Buie says the group was able to remove two large barriers to energy storage: cost and performance. Membranes are often the most costly component of a battery, and the most unreliable, as they can corrode with repeated exposure to certain reactants.

Braff built a prototype of a flow battery with a small channel between two electrodes. Through the channel, the group pumped liquid bromine over a graphite cathode and hydrobromic acid under a porous anode. At the same time, the researchers flowed hydrogen gas across the anode. The resulting reactions between hydrogen and bromine produced energy in the form of free electrons that can be discharged or released.

The researchers were also able to reverse the chemical reaction within the channel to capture electrons and store energy -- a first for any membraneless design.

In experiments, Braff and his colleagues operated the flow battery at room temperature over a range of flow rates and reactant concentrations. They found that the battery produced a maximum power density of 0.795 watts of stored energy per square centimeter.

More storage, less cost

In addition to conducting experiments, the researchers drew up a mathematical model to describe the chemical reactions in a hydrogen-bromine system. Their predictions from the model agreed with their experimental results -- an outcome that Bazant sees as promising for the design of future iterations.

"We have a design tool now that gives us confidence that as we try to scale up this system, we can make rational decisions about what the optimal system dimensions should be," Bazant says. "We believe we can break records of power density with more engineering guided by the model."

Yury Gogotsi, a professor of materials science and engineering at Drexel University, says eliminating the membrane is the next step toward scalable, inexpensive energy storage. The group's design, he says, will help engineers better understand the physics of membraneless systems.

"You cannot have an inexpensive energy-storage system by piling up tens of thousands of individual small cells, like cellphone or computer batteries," says Gogotsi, who did not contribute to the research. "As any new technology, the laminar flow battery will need time to prove its viability. It's like a newborn baby -- we'll only know what the technology is good for after a few years."

According to preliminary projections, Braff and his colleagues estimate that the membraneless flow battery may produce energy costing as little as $100 per kilowatt-hour -- a goal that the U.S. Department of Energy has estimated would be economically attractive to utility companies.

"You can do so much to make the grid more efficient if you can get to a cost point like that," Braff says. "Most systems are easily an order of magnitude higher, and no one's ever built anything at that price."

Embedded Systems LIN slave mop-up chip meets ISO26262

Embedded Systems LIN slave mop-up chip meets ISO26262

2013/08/16

21aug13AS8530blockAMS had introduced a LIN companion chip for MCUs that complies with the automotive ISO26262 functional safety standard, claiming it to be the first.

“ISO26262 compliance has added a new layer of complexity and difficulty to the task of designing many automotive systems,” said AMS general manager Bernd Gessner.

The 8pin AS8530 includes a LIN 2.1 transceiver, a 50mA LDO for a local MCU, a reset generator, an output voltage monitor, and a unique chip ID.

“As a differentiator, the AS8530 offers a series of system management functions through a shared pin serial interface, all within the same SOIC8 package,” said the firm. The addition of diagnosis functions provides built-in support for the requirements of ISO26262.”

It also has a two-wire serial port (sharing the Enable and TX pins) that allows status registers and diagnosis information to be read by the local microcontroller.

And there is a window watchdog, and back-up registers to store data when the microcontroller shuts down.

“These features are crucial in the design of ISO26262-compliant systems, which must be able to cease operation safely when in a fault condition, before the vehicle is at risk of endangering passengers or other road users,” said AMS. “The AS8530 is suitable for any LIN-networked sensor and actuator slaves, including those found in door modules, sunroofs and headlight positioning units. It is suited to safety-critical systems that require an ASIL grading under the provisions of ISO26262.”

The LDO is factory set to 3.3V or 5V.

Normal, power-saving, stand-by and sleep modes can be triggered through the Enable pin.

DSPs, General 640GFLOPS card for image sensor processing

DSPs, General 640GFLOPS card for image sensor processing

2013/08/16

07aug13agility

CommAgility’s AMC-4C6678 Advanced Mezzanine Card (AMC) DSP board has four TMS320C6678 fixed- and floating-point octal core DSPs from Texas Instruments running at 1.25GHz.

The total aggregated performance is 640GFLOPS and 1,280GMACS.

Intended for image sensor processing and stepper control, the AMC-4C6678 has I/O to support the 32 DSP cores. PCI Express and Gigabit Ethernet interfaces use on-board switches for maximum flexibility and access to all DSPs on the card.

A serial rapidIO (SRIO) link is directly connected to one DSP, shared using Hyperlink and then extends to the second DSP pair. 8Gbyte of DDR3 SDRAM is provided as standard, with 2Gbyte allocated to each DSP. 256Mbyte of flash memory is also provided, which can be used to store DSP boot code.

Available software includes full board support libraries and an IP stack with Telnet/TFTP for Ethernet-based board control and upgrade.

The new module is a compact full-size, single width PICMG AMC.0 R2.0 AMC, and is suitable for use in both ATCA carriers and MicroTCA chassis.

Business Maxim buys power chip firm Volterra

Business Maxim buys power chip firm Volterra

2013/08/16

24jul13CEO Tunc Doluca_2Fabless Californian power chip maker Volterra is to be acquired by Maxim.

“Volterra is an industry leader in high-current, high-performance, and high-density power management solutions,” said Maxim. “The company develops highly integrated solutions primarily for the enterprise, cloud computing, communications, and networking markets.”

“With Volterra, we will strengthen our position in the enterprise and communications markets,” said Maxim CEO Tunç Doluca. “We add a talented team and leading-edge proprietary technology in high-current power management solutions, which further diversifies our business model.”

The firm will be acquired for $23 per share in a transaction valued at $605m equity value; $450m enterprise value, said Maxim.

Pending regulatory approvals, Maxim’s acquisition of Volterra is expected to close “early in the December quarter”, said Maxim.

Analogue / Linear / Mixed Signal ICs Intersil designs voltage chip for space systems

Analogue / Linear / Mixed Signal ICs Intersil designs voltage chip for space systems

2013/08/16

Intersil has designed its latest radiation hardened (rad-hard) voltage references to have low output noise.

The ISL71090SEH12 and ISL71090SEH25 voltage references are fabbed on an SOI-based PR40 process specified to provide Single Event Latch-up (SEL) immunity to ensure robust performance in heavy ion environments.

The ISL71090SEHx voltage references when used in analogue-to-digital conversion provide initial voltage accuracy of ±0.05%, and ±0.15% over the entire military temperature and radiation exposure ranges.

The temperature coefficient is 10ppm/deg C and output noise is specified at 2µVp-p at 2.5Vout, and 1µVp-p at 1.25Vout.

Input voltage range is 4V to 30V and supports multiple system power rails.

SET mitigation designed to use single output capacitor for LET threshold of 86MeV.cm2/mg.

The ISL71090SEHx voltage references (1.25V and 2.5V) are available now in 8-lead flatpack. The ISL71090SEH12EV1Z and ISL71090SEH25EV1Z evaluation boards offer two voltage options, 1.25V and 2.5V respectively, and measure the performance of the ISL71090SEHx voltage references.

Business Industrial IC market flat

Business Industrial IC market flat

2013/08/16

Inustrial IC revenue grewb1% y-y in Qi to $7.7 billion , says IHS. Q4 had seen a 3 % decline y-o-y.

“The industrial semiconductor market’s performance was encouraging, especially in light of continuing global economic uncertainty and the seasonal nature of the market, which typically sees slower movement in the first quarter of every year,” says Robbie Galoso, at IHS, “Some large segments of the industry, particularly avionics and oil and gas process-automation equipment, saw muscular double-digit gains, helping to drive up overall revenue.”

In another positive development, several large industrial semiconductor suppliers also reported very lean inventories because of strong orders from customers.

Infineon, ADI and TI saw sequential declines in industrial chip stockpiles as their days of inventory (DOI) measure fell well below average.

“The individual sectors for lighting, security, climate control and medical imaging were deleteriously impacted in the first quarter,” says Galoso.

The military and civil aerospace market had the most robust performance among all industrial semiconductor segments in the first quarter. Avionics was especially vigorous, driven by commercial aircraft sales from pan-European entity EADS Airbus and U.S. maker Boeing, up 9 percent and 14 percent, respectively, on the quarter.

The oil and gas exploration market also saw solid revenue growth, with strong subsea systems and drilling equipment driving sales for ABB, Honeywell and GE.

In contrast to those high-performing segments, lackluster sales were reported in the markets for building and home control, for energy generation and distribution, and for test and measurement. One other market, manufacturing and process automation, reported stable growth, even though its sector for motor drives remained in negative territory.

Spaceflight alters bacterial social networks

Spaceflight alters bacterial social networks

Aug. 15, 2013 — When astronauts launch into space, a microbial entourage follows. And the sheer number of these followers would give celebrities on Twitter a run for their money. The estimate is that normal, healthy adults have ten times as many microbial cells as human cells within their bodies; countless more populate the environment around us. Although invisible to the naked eye, microorganisms -- some friend, some foe -- are found practically everywhere.

Microorganisms like bacteria often are found attached to surfaces living in communities known as biofilms. Bacteria within biofilms are protected by a slimy matrix that they secrete. Skip brushing your teeth tomorrow morning and you may personally experience what a biofilm feels like.

One of NASA's goals is to minimize the health risks associated with extended spaceflight, so it is critical that methods for preventing and treating spaceflight-induced illnesses be developed before astronauts embark upon long-duration space missions. It is important for NASA to learn how bacterial communities that play roles in human health and disease are affected by spaceflight.

In two NASA-funded studies -- Micro-2 and Micro-2A -- biofilms made by the bacteria Pseudomonas aeruginosa were cultured on Earth and aboard space shuttle Atlantis in 2010 and 2011 to determine the impact of microgravity on their behavior. P. aeruginosa is an opportunistic human pathogen that is commonly used for biofilm studies. The research team compared the biofilms grown aboard the International Space Station bound space shuttle with those grown on the ground. The study results show for the first time that spaceflight changes the behavior of bacterial communities.

Although most bacterial biofilms are harmless, some threaten human health and safety. Biofilms can exhibit increased resistance to the immune system's defenses or treatment with antibiotics. They also can damage vital equipment aboard spacecraft by corroding surfaces or clogging air and water purification systems that provide life support for astronauts. Biofilms cause similar problems on Earth.

"Biofilms were rampant on the Mir space station and continue to be a challenge on the International Space Station, but we still don't really know what role gravity plays in their growth and development," said Cynthia Collins, Ph.D., principal investigator for the study and assistant professor in the Department of Chemical and Biological Engineering at the Center for Biotechnology and Interdisciplinary Studies at the Rensselaer Polytechnic Institute in Troy, N.Y. "Before we start sending astronauts to Mars or embarking on other long-term spaceflight missions, we need to be as certain as possible that we have eliminated or significantly reduced the risk that biofilms pose to the human crew and their equipment."

In 2010 and 2011, during the STS-132 and STS-135 missions aboard space shuttle Atlantis, astronauts in space and scientists on Earth performed nearly simultaneous parallel experiments; both teams cultured samples of P. aeruginosa bacteria using conditions that encouraged biofilm formation.

Identical hardware designed for growing cells during spaceflight were used for both the flight and ground studies. According to Collins, "artificial urine was chosen as a growth medium because it is a physiologically relevant environment for the study of biofilms formed both inside and outside the human body."

Biofilms were cultured inside specialized fluid processing apparatus composed of glass tubes divided into chambers. The researchers loaded each tube with a membrane that provided a surface on which the bacteria could grow; the artificial urine was used for the bacteria's nourishment. Samples of P. aeruginosa were loaded into separate chambers within each tube.

The prepared tubes were placed in groups of eight inside another specialized device called a group activation pack (GAP) -- designed to activate all of the bacterial cultures at once. The research team prepared identical sets of GAPs for the concurrent spaceflight and ground experiments.

Astronauts aboard the shuttle initiated the flight experiments by operating the GAPs and introducing the bacteria to the artificial urine medium. Scientists on Earth performed the same operations with the control group of GAPs at NASA's Kennedy Space Center in Florida. After activation, the GAPs were housed in incubators on Earth and aboard the shuttle to maintain temperatures appropriate for bacterial growth.

After the microgravity samples returned to Earth, the researchers determined the thickness of the biofilms, the number of living cells and the volume of biofilm per area on the membranes. Additionally, they used a microscopy technique that allowed them to capture high-resolution images at different depths within the biofilms, revealing details of their three-dimensional structures.

What the scientists found was that the P. aeruginosa biofilms grown in space contained more cells, more mass and were thicker than the control biofilms grown on Earth. When they viewed the microscopy images of the space-grown biofilms, the researchers saw a unique, previously unobserved structure consisting of a dense mat-like "canopy" structure supported above the membrane by "columns." The Earth grown biofilms were uniformly dense, flat structures. These results provide the first evidence that spaceflight affects community-level behavior of bacteria.

Microbes experience "low shear" conditions in microgravity that resemble conditions inside the human body, but are difficult to study. According to Collins, "Beyond its importance for astronauts and future space explorers, this research also could lead to novel methods for preventing and treating human disease on Earth. Examining the effects of spaceflight on biofilm formation can provide new insights into how different factors, such as gravity, fluid dynamics and nutrient availability affect biofilm formation on Earth. Additionally, the research findings one day could help inform new, innovative approaches for curbing the spread of infections in hospitals."

NASA's Space Biology Program funded the Micro-2 and Micro-2A investigations. Related space biology research continues aboard the space station, including recently selected studies that are planned for future launch to the orbiting laboratory.

Wherever we go, microbial communities will faithfully follow, making this evidence of the effects of spaceflight on bacterial physiology relevant to human health. That bacterial biofilms exhibit different behavior in space versus on Earth is critical information as NASA strives to keep astronauts healthy and safe during future long-duration space missions.

New species of carnivore looks like a cross between a house cat and a teddy bear

New species of carnivore looks like a cross between a house cat and a teddy bear

The team's discovery is published in the Aug. 15 issue of the journal ZooKeys.

The olinguito (oh-lin-GHEE-toe) looks like a cross between a house cat and a teddy bear. It is actually the latest scientifically documented member of the family Procyonidae, which it shares with raccoons, coatis, kinkajous and olingos. The 2-pound olinguito, with its large eyes and woolly orange-brown fur, is native to the cloud forests of Colombia and Ecuador, as its scientific name, "neblina" (Spanish for "fog"), hints. In addition to being the latest described member of its family, another distinction the olinguito holds is that it is the newest species in the order Carnivora -- an incredibly rare discovery in the 21st century.

"The discovery of the olinguito shows us that the world is not yet completely explored, its most basic secrets not yet revealed," said Kristofer Helgen, curator of mammals at the Smithsonian's National Museum of Natural History and leader of the team reporting the new discovery. "If new carnivores can still be found, what other surprises await us? So many of the world's species are not yet known to science. Documenting them is the first step toward understanding the full richness and diversity of life on Earth."

Discovering a new species of carnivore, however, does not happen overnight. This one took a decade, and was not the project's original goal -- completing the first comprehensive study of olingos, several species of tree-living carnivores in the genus Bassaricyon, was. Helgen's team wanted to understand how many olingo species should be recognized and how these species are distributed -- issues that had long been unclear to scientists. Unexpectedly, the team's close examination of more than 95 percent of the world's olingo specimens in museums, along with DNA testing and the review of historic field data, revealed existence of the olinguito, a previously undescribed species.

The first clue came to Helgen from the olinguito's teeth and skull, which were smaller and differently shaped than those of olingos. Examining museum skins revealed that this new species was also smaller overall with a longer and denser coat; field records showed that it occurred in a unique area of the northern Andes Mountains at 5,000 to 9,000 feet above sea level -- elevations much higher than the known species of olingo. This information, however, was coming from overlooked olinguito specimens collected in the early 20th century. The question Helgen and his team wanted to answer next was: Does the olinguito still exist in the wild?

To answer that question, Helgen called on Roland Kays, director of the Biodiversity and Earth Observation Lab at the North Carolina Museum of Natural Sciences, to help organize a field expedition.

"The data from the old specimens gave us an idea of where to look, but it still seemed like a shot in the dark," Kays said. "But these Andean forests are so amazing that even if we didn't find the animal we were looking for, I knew our team would discover something cool along the way."

The team had a lucky break that started with a camcorder video. With confirmation of the olinguito's existence via a few seconds of grainy video shot by their colleague Miguel Pinto, a zoologist in Ecuador, Helgen and Kays set off on a three-week expedition to find the animal themselves. Working with Pinto, they found olinguitos in a forest on the western slopes of the Andes, and spent their days documenting what they could about the animal -- its characteristics and its forest home. Because the olinguito was new to science, it was imperative for the scientists to record every aspect of the animal. They learned that the olinguito is mostly active at night, is mainly a fruit eater, rarely comes out of the trees and has one baby at a time.

In addition to body features and behavior, the team made special note of the olinguito's cloud forest Andean habitat, which is under heavy pressure of human development. The team estimated that 42 percent of historic olinguito habitat has already been converted to agriculture or urban areas.

"The cloud forests of the Andes are a world unto themselves, filled with many species found nowhere else, many of them threatened or endangered," Helgen said. "We hope that the olinguito can serve as an ambassador species for the cloud forests of Ecuador and Colombia, to bring the world's attention to these critical habitats."

While the olinguito is new to science, it is not a stranger to people. People have been living in or near the olinguito's cloud forest world for thousands of years. And while misidentified, specimens have been in museums for more than 100 years, and at least one olinguito from Colombia was exhibited in several zoos in the United States during the 1960s and 1970s. There were even several occasions during the past century when the olinguito came close to being discovered but was not. In 1920, a zoologist in New York thought an olinguito museum specimen was so unusual that it might be a new species, but he never followed through in publishing the discovery.

Giving the olinguito its scientific name is just the beginning. "This is the first step," Helgen said. "Proving that a species exists and giving it a name is where everything starts. This is a beautiful animal, but we know so little about it. How many countries does it live in? What else can we learn about its behavior? What do we need to do to ensure its conservation?" Helgen is already planning his next mission into the clouds.

More than 28 cups of coffee a week may endanger health in under 55s

More than 28 cups of coffee a week may endanger health in under 55s

Aug. 15, 2013 — Nearly 400 million cups of coffee are consumed every day in America. Drinking large amounts of coffee may be bad for under-55s, according to a new study published in Mayo Clinic Proceedings. A study of more than 40,000 individuals found a statistically significant 21% increased mortality in those drinking more than 28 cups of coffee a week and death from all causes, with a greater than 50% increased mortality risk in both men and women younger than 55 years of age. Investigators warn that younger people in particular may need to avoid heavy coffee consumption. No adverse effects were found in heavy coffee drinkers aged over 55.

Drinking coffee has become a normal daily routine for large numbers of people worldwide. According to the latest National Coffee Drinking Study from the National Coffee Association, more than 60% of American adults drink coffee every day, consuming on average just over three cups a day.

Coffee has long been suspected to contribute to a variety of chronic health conditions, although earlier studies on coffee consumption in relation to deaths from all causes and deaths from coronary heart disease are limited, and the results are often controversial.

A multicenter research team investigated the effect of coffee consumption on death from all causes and deaths from cardiovascular disease in the Aerobics Center Longitudinal Study (ACLS) cohort, with an average follow-up period of 16 years and a relatively large sample size of over 40,000 men and women.

Between 1979 and 1998, nearly 45,000 individuals aged between 20 and 87 years old participated and returned a medical history questionnaire assessing lifestyle habits (including coffee consumption) and personal and family medical history. The investigators examined a total of 43,727 participants (33,900 men and 9,827 women) in their final analysis.

During the 17-year median follow-up period there were 2,512 deaths (men: 87.5%; women: 12.5%), 32% of these caused by cardiovascular disease. Those who consumed higher amounts of coffee (both men and women) were more likely to smoke and had lower levels of cardiorespiratory fitness.

All participants were followed from the baseline examination to date of death or until December 31, 2003. Deaths from all causes and deaths from cardiovascular disease were identified through the National Death Index or by accessing death certificates.

Younger men had a trend towards higher mortality even at lower consumption, but this became significant at about 28 cups per week where there was a 56% increase in mortality from all causes. Younger women who consumed more than 28 cups of coffee per week also had a greater than 2-fold higher risk of all-cause mortality than those who did not drink coffee.

Senior investigator Steven H. Blair, PED, of the Department of Biostatistics and Epidemiology, Arnold School of Public Health, University of South Carolina, emphasizes that "Significantly, the results did not demonstrate any association between coffee consumption and all-cause mortality among older men and women. It is also important to note that none of the doses of coffee in either men or women whether younger or older had any significant effects on cardiovascular mortality."

Coffee is a complex mixture of chemicals consisting of thousands of components. Recent research has found that coffee is one of the major sources of antioxidants in the diet and has potential beneficial effects on inflammation and cognitive function. However, it is also well-known that coffee has potential adverse effects because of caffeine's potential to stimulate the release of epinephrine, inhibit insulin activity, and increase blood pressure and levels of homocysteine.

"Thus, all of these mechanisms could counterbalance one another. Research also suggests that heavy coffee drinkers may experience additional risk through potential genetic mechanisms or because of confounding through the deleterious effects of other risk factors with which coffee drinking is associated," say lead authors, Junxiu Liu, MD, Department of Biostatistics and Epidemiology, and Xuemei Sui, MD, MPH, PhD, Department of Exercise Science, both at the Arnold School of Public Health, University of South Carolina, "Therefore, we hypothesize that the positive association between coffee and mortality may be due to the interaction of age and coffee consumption, combined with a component of genetic coffee addiction."

The investigators suggest that younger people in particular should avoid heavy coffee consumption of more than 28 cups a week or four cups in a typical day. However, they emphasize that further studies are needed in different populations to assess details regarding the effects of long-term coffee consumption and changes in coffee consumption over time on all-cause and cardiovascular disease mortality.

Leading expert Carl J. Lavie, MD, of the Department of Cardiovascular Diseases, Ochsner Medical Center, New Orleans, and a co-author of this study, explains that "There continues to be considerable debate about the health effects of caffeine, and coffee specifically, with some reports suggesting toxicity and some even suggesting beneficial effects."
